All our dogs are located IN Washington State - we are a local foster based rescue and no transport from another state required. :) Thanks! --- Meet Greta. This green-eyed beauty was found as a stray along a UPS route and the driver gave her to one of our fosters. Beyond her beauty, she's a smart, active little girl. We are calling her a husky mix, with what, we are not quite sure, maybe shepherd, so a Shepsky? Based on her age about 12 weeks, we think she will be in the 65# range - she's only about 15# currently. She's not 'huge' for her age. In her foster home she is confident but also respectful of the other dogs. Greta is curious and getting all new experiences in her new space. She's learning crate life and can be a little vocal when unhappy... go figure! :) Greta is very sweet and likely going to be a dog that will love daily walks and hiking adventures. We always love another friendly dog in the home to show puppies the way - or she needs to be socialized with other young dogs to keep her happy. A fully fenced yard would be great. She just arrived to WA and we will get more photos! This puppy is spayed, microchipped and vaccinated to appropriate age when they go home. She will need more puppy shots at 16 weeks. Puppies are good with dogs, cats, kids and more. Being a puppy, they will need lots of training, including housebreaking. Remember, puppies are cute, but they have sharp teeth, need to be fed 3 times a day and poop... a lot! The 3-3-3 rule is a guideline for transitioning a rescue dog into its new home and helping it to settle in. It suggests that the first three days should be used for adjusting to its new surroundings, the next three weeks for training and bonding, and the first three months for continued socialization and training.
